I ordered 6 Caribean Blue Chromis off Divers den as a package, the fish are all beautiful active. They don't like my frozen food much, but, they did eat some and are doing well in my tank (at least for the first 4 hours) and they all arrived in individual bags, with tons of air. They were packaged amazingly well! They were from the Wisconsin Biota facility. The fish were way more beautiful than I expected. I got an ORA clown fish shipped from the California facility. The heat pack was cold, the fish was tiny. Less than quarter inch (probably shouldn't have been sold yet?) And it was dead in the bag.. The bag was so tiny, it was about the size of one of those small coral baggies I've seen corals shipped in. The water was freezing cold, so pretty sure it froze to death. It would be nice to get consistent service from the different LA facilities. Overall extremely pleased with the Divers Den. Very displeased with general stock.

I have gotten fish from LA from California that arrived healthy and survived. I had ordered two pyramid butterflies. Not cheap fish by any means. One arrived not looking well but figured it was just shipping stress. Put both in. one is still alive to this day the other one never started eating and died within 2 days of being added. I was able to get credit for the dead one, so, I do appreciate the warranty. Prior to that I've ordered probably a total of 15 fish from LA and I haven't lost a single one prior to the Pyramid Butterfly loss.

Out of my current 25 fish 23 came from LA and are all healthy. I do appreciate the guarantees! I would state that the stuff from DD out of Biota and Wisconsin are steps above the quality of care, handling, and quality of specimens is way higher. But that said, I have had good experiences. It is unfortunate we hear mainly about the bad.
